Campaign underway to save A.B. Ellis school building

The move to save the A.B. Ellis Public School building begins on Wednesday.  Residents are joining together to protect the building from the wrecking ball by having it declared a heritage site.  Sharon Sproule is one of those leading the charge and she says the school could be converted into a multi-use centre including using its stage.  The 90-year-old structure is to be demolished next year.  The Save A.B. Ellis committee has a meeting this evening to talk about how to save the school.  It’s at the Espanola United Church and begins at 7:30pm.
